Flowers have long been used as symbolic gifts to celebrate special occasions, including birthdays. Choosing flowers according to someone’s birth month adds a personal touch to the gift, making it even more meaningful and memorable.

In this post, we’ll explore the top tips for selecting flowers based on birth month, along with their symbolic meanings, to help you find the perfect floral gift for your loved ones.

January: Carnations

Carnations are the birth flower for January, symbolizing love, admiration, and distinction. When choosing carnations, consider the color, as each hue carries a different meaning:

  • Red: Love and affection
  • White: Pure love and good luck
  • Pink: Gratitude and appreciation

Tip: Pair carnations with snowdrops, another January flower, to create a stunning winter-themed bouquet of these delightful birthday flowers.

February: Violets

Violets represent faithfulness, wisdom, and humility, making them the ideal flower for February birthdays. These delicate blooms are available in shades of purple, blue, and white.

Tip: Combine violets with primroses, another February flower, for a charming and colorful arrangement.

March: Daffodils

Daffodils symbolize new beginnings, rebirth, and unrequited love, reflecting the arrival of spring in March. These cheerful, trumpet-shaped flowers come in shades of yellow, white, and orange.

Tip: Create a mixed bouquet of daffodils and jonquils, a close relative, to represent March’s vibrant energy.

April: Daisies

Daisies represent purity, innocence, and loyal love, making them a fitting choice for April birthdays. With their classic white petals and sunny yellow centers, daisies are versatile and universally loved flowers.

Tip: Combine daisies with sweet peas, another April birth flower, for a fragrant and eye-catching bouquet.

May: Lily Of The Valley

Lily of the Valley symbolizes sweetness, humility, and a return to happiness, embodying the beauty and renewal of May. These delicate, bell-shaped flowers are white and highly fragrant.

Tip: Pair Lily of the Valley with hawthorn blossoms, another May birth flower, to create a unique and enchanting arrangement.

June: Roses

Roses are the birth flower for June, symbolizing love, passion, and beauty. With a variety of colors to choose from, you can personalize your rose bouquet to convey different emotions:

  • Red: Love and romance
  • Yellow: Friendship and joy
  • Pink: Gratitude and admiration
  • White: Purity and innocence

Tip: Combine roses with honeysuckle, another June flower, for a fragrant and romantic bouquet.

July: Larkspur

Larkspur represents strong bonds of love, making it a fitting choice for July birthdays. These tall, spiky flowers come in a range of colors, including blue, purple, pink, and white.

Tip: Pair larkspur with water lilies, another July birth flower, for a unique and visually stunning arrangement.

August: Gladiolus

Gladiolus symbolizes strength, integrity, and moral character, reflecting the strong spirit of those born in August. These striking, sword-shaped flowers come in a variety of colors, including red, pink, yellow, and white.

Tip: Combine gladiolus with poppies, another August birth flower, for a bold and dramatic bouquet.

September: Asters

Asters represent wisdom, love, and patience, making them a beautiful choice for September birthdays. These star-shaped flowers are available in shades of purple, pink, blue, and white.

Tip: Pair asters with morning glories, another September birth flower, for a charming and whimsical arrangement.

October: Marigolds

Marigolds symbolize warmth, grace, and protection, embodying the vibrant spirit of October. These bright, cheerful flowers are available in shades of orange, yellow, and red.

Tip: Combine marigolds with cosmos, another October birth flower, for a colorful and uplifting bouquet.

November: Chrysanthemums

Chrysanthemums represent loyalty, honesty, and friendship, making them a thoughtful choice for November birthdays. These versatile flowers come in a wide range of colors, including red, yellow, white, and purple.

Tip: Pair chrysanthemums with thistles, another November birth flower, for a unique and texturally interesting arrangement.

December: Narcissus

Narcissus, also known as paperwhites, symbolizes hope, renewal, and self-esteem, making them a fitting choice for December birthdays. These fragrant flowers feature white, star-shaped blooms.

Tip: Combine narcissus with holly, another December birth flower, to create a festive and meaningful bouquet.

Floral Care Tips For Longer-Lasting Bouquets

To ensure your chosen birth month flowers look their best and last as long as possible, follow these floral care tips:

• Trim the stems: Before placing the flowers in a vase, cut the stems at a 45-degree angle to allow for better water absorption.

• Remove lower leaves: Strip any leaves that would be submerged in water to prevent bacterial growth.

• Use a clean vase: Make sure the vase is clean to minimize bacteria and promote the longevity of the flowers.

• Fresh water: Change the water in the vase every couple of days or as soon as it starts to look cloudy.

• Flower food: Add a packet of commercial flower food or a homemade solution (such as a mix of sugar, vinegar, and water) to provide nutrients and prevent bacteria.

• Temperature: Keep the bouquet away from direct sunlight, heat sources, and drafts to prolong the freshness of the flowers.

• Monitor: Remove any wilting flowers or leaves to prevent the spread of bacteria to other blooms.
